StudentNewsDaily.com - A News Source for High Schoolers
StudentNewsDaily.com is a great website for growing and developing teenagers into critical thinkers when processing news and events in the media.
A description of their purpose:
"StudentNewsDaily.com is a non-profit current events website for high school students. Our goal is to build students' knowledge of current events and strengthen their critical thinking skills. This is done by providing comprehension and critical thinking questions along with published news articles and other current events items from established news organizations. We provide resources that will enable students to become informed viewers and readers of the news."
StudentNewsDaily.com also helpfully has a general breakdown of Conservative vs. Liberal beliefs on a multitude of issues and how to be an educated voter. They have a quote of the week, an end of the week news quiz, daily best of the web, and daily news article.
World Magazine - News with a Biblical Perspective
I've recently started receiving World magazine, delivered every other week, that shares national and international news tempered with a Biblical perspective. It is especially helpful as it presents a perspective often missing from biased and liberal mainstream media sources. It is also unique in that it presents issues, events, and stories that are often not reported or given adequate attention elsewhere.
World covers a broad spectrum of news, to include business, politics, books, music, movies, TV shows, quotes, moral/ethical issues, culture, technology, sports, and church related news.
World magazine is a great way to stay accurately informed without being overwhelmed or slowly brainwashed!
